City of York Hosts Narcan Distribution on Tuesday, August 27th at York City Hall

The City of York Bureau of Health, York/Adams Drug and Alcohol Commission, and York Opioid Collaborative have been working together to distribute Narcan the 4th Tuesday of each month. Narcan can save the life of someone suffering an overdose from opioids.

On Tuesday, August 27, 2024, the monthly Narcan distribution event will continue to take place at City Hall (101 S George St.). Individuals can pick up Narcan (outside and in front of City Hall) and receive a brief training on how to recognize and respond to an opioid overdose.

It is highly recommended to add Narcan to first aid kits. An individual suffering from an overdose is a medical emergency, and it is best to be prepared for these types of emergencies. Bystanders are often the first to be in the presence or witness an individual experiencing an overdose, which is why it is important to have Narcan easily accessible. Anyone who is prescribed an opioid medication is at risk for overdose.
